One of the primary advantages of custom wall closets is their ability to maximize space. Many bedrooms come with awkward corners or unusual dimensions that standard closets simply can't accommodate. With custom designs, you can utilize every inch of available space, ensuring that no corner goes unused. This can be particularly beneficial in smaller bedrooms where storage is limited. By having a wall closet that fits snugly into your room's layout, you can free up more floor space and create a more open atmosphere.
Additionally, custom wall closets allow for a high degree of personalization. You can choose the materials, colors, and finishes that match your personal style and the overall theme of your bedroom. Whether you prefer a modern, sleek look or a more traditional wooden finish, the options are virtually endless. You can even incorporate unique features like built-in lighting, mirrors, or pull-out drawers to enhance functionality and style. This level of customization can transform a simple storage solution into a stylish focal point of your bedroom.
Another significant benefit is the organizational potential of custom wall closets. When you design your closet, you can create specific sections for different types of clothing, accessories, and shoes. This means no more digging through piles of clothes or struggling to find your favorite pair of shoes. Everything has its own place, which can significantly reduce stress and make getting ready in the morning a breeze. You can include shelves, hanging rods, and even compartments for jewelry or hats, depending on your needs.
Moreover, custom wall closets can be a fantastic investment in your home. Not only do they enhance your living space, but they can also increase the overall value of your property. Potential buyers often appreciate well-organized and aesthetically pleasing storage solutions. When it comes time to sell your home, having custom wall closets could set your property apart from others on the market.

FAQ
1. What is the average cost of custom wall closets? The cost can vary widely based on materials and design complexity but typically ranges from $1,000 to $5,000.
2. How long does it take to install a custom wall closet? Installation can take anywhere from a few hours to a couple of days, depending on the size and complexity of the design.
3. Can I incorporate lighting into my custom wall closet? Yes! Many designers offer built-in lighting options to enhance visibility and aesthetics.
